The aim of this guide is to provide laboratories with guidance on best practice for the analytical operations they carry out.
The guidance covers both qualitative and quantitative analysis carried out on a routine or non-routine basis. It is intended to help those implementing quality assurance in laboratories. For those working towards accreditation, certification, or other compliance with particular quality requirements, it will help explain what these requirements mean.
The guidance will also be useful to those involved in the quality assessment of analytical laboratories against those quality requirements.
Cross-references to ISO/IEC 17025, ISO 9000 and OECD Good Laboratory Practice (GLP) requirements are provided.
This document has been developed from the previous CITAC Guide 1 (which in turn was based on the EURACHEM/WELAC Guide), and updated to take account of new material and developments, particularly the new requirements of the standard, ISO/IEC 17025.
